The East Building at 4147 Woodland Avenue presents a distinctive leasing opportunity in Philadelphia’s Spruce Hill Historic District. This two-story office property, originally built in 1900 and renovated in 2006, offers a refined setting for professional, institutional, or medical tenants seeking a location with character and connectivity. Formerly home to Saint Joseph’s University’s Department of Humanities, the building is well-suited for administrative or academic functions. Located on a 2,838 SF corner lot with frontage on both Woodland Avenue and South 42nd Street, the property benefits from excellent visibility and walkability. Tenants will appreciate the convenience of over ten nearby bus stops and access to the 40th Street Trolley, making commuting effortless for staff and visitors alike. The building features 13.5-foot ceiling heights, concrete floors, and a flat roof, offering flexible interior layouts and a solid infrastructure for customization. Zoned CMX-1, the space accommodates a range of neighborhood-serving commercial uses, including sole practitioners, civic institutions, and professional offices. The surrounding Spruce Hill Historic District adds prestige and charm, with its nationally recognized Victorian-era architecture and vibrant community atmosphere. This is an ideal setting for tenants seeking a unique, well-connected office environment in West Philadelphia.
